Overview: Bill Number: LC 3022, Title: Generally revise consumer protection laws, Status: (LC) Draft Died in Process, Introduced: December 13, 2024
Purpose and Intent: The purpose of this bill is to make comprehensive updates and revisions to the state's consumer protection laws. The goal is to strengthen consumer rights and safeguards in the marketplace.
Key Provisions:
- Expands the definition of unfair and deceptive business practices
- Increases penalties and fines for violations of consumer protection laws
- Enhances the state attorney general's enforcement and investigative powers
- Requires businesses to provide more transparent disclosures to consumers
- Establishes new protections for consumers in specific industries, such as financial services and data privacy
Affected Parties and Impacts:
- Consumers in the state would benefit from the enhanced protections and rights
- Businesses would need to comply with the new consumer protection requirements
- The state attorney general's office would have increased authority to investigate and prosecute violations
Procedural and Timeline Considerations:
This bill was introduced in December 2024 but did not progress further in the legislative process, and the draft died.
